2. Erste Schritte

 

 

Es geht los! Sie sollen gleich Ihr erstes Programm in Java schreiben und austesten. Beim ersten Programm, das man in einem neuen Zusammenhang schreibt, spricht man oft vom "Hello World" - Programm, da es keinen andern Zweck hat, als irgendwas zu tun - oft eben einfach "Hello World" auf den Bildschirm zu schreiben (bei Ihnen darf es dann auch was anderes sein!).

Wir gehen die Schritte der Programmentwicklung durch: Editieren, Übersetzen, Ausführen.



 
Editieren
  • Klicken Sie unten auf "Start" und wählen Sie "Programme", "Zubehör", "Editor" (bzw. "Notepad"): Sie haben eine einfache Textverarbeitung geöffnet.
  • Schreiben Sie folgendes Java - Programm:

 
 


// Mein erstes Java - Programm
public class HalloWelt {
  public static void main(String args[]) {
    System.out.println("Hallo Welt, da bin ich!");
  }
}


 
 


Achtung:

Gross- und Kleinschreibung ist in Java von Bedeutung.

Und: Das Einrücken ist nicht vorgeschrieben, aber sehr zu empfehlen.

  • Speichern Sie Ihren Text unter dem Namen "HalloWelt.java" z.B. im Ordner "d:\meinname" . Achtung: Beim Dateityp nicht "Textdateien (*.txt)", sondern "Alle Dateien" wählen!
 
Übersetzen und ausführen
  • Klicken Sie auf "Start" und wählen Sie aus "Programme", "Zubehör" die "Eingabeaufforderung": In einem Fenster erhalten Sie die DOS - Oberfläche, die es erlaubt, DOS - Kommandos einzugeben.
  • Wechseln Sie in das Verzeichnis mit Ihrem Programm: z.B. "cd d:\meinnamel".
  • Geben Sie "dir HalloWelt.*" ein. Sie sollten in der Liste die Datei HalloWelt.java sehen. Wenn nicht, versuchen Sie es nochmals oder rufen Sie mich!
  • Geben Sie ein
    " c:\j2sdk1.4.2_08\bin\javac HalloWelt.java": Der Java - Compiler übersetzt Ihr Programm in Byte Code. Gab es keine Rückmeldung? Dann ist alles o.k. Gab es Fehlermeldung(en)? Dann korrigieren Sie im Editor, speichern Sie und übersetzen Sie wieder mit javac, bis das Programm fehlerfrei ist.
  • Geben Sie ein "dir HalloWelt.*": Sie sehen, dass javac eine neue Datei mit der Endung ".class" erstellt hat - das ist der Byte - Code Ihres Programms, den Sie jetzt per Internet in die ganze Welt verschicken könnten!
  • Wir sind aber viel bescheidener und lassen das Programm nur auf unserer Maschine laufen: Geben Sie ein "java HalloWelt" (ohne ".class"!).
  • Falls Sie auf der nächsten Zeile den Text aus Ihrem Programm sehen, ist Ihr erstes Java Programm gelaufen - gratuliere! Falls nicht, rufen Sie mich.
  • Kopieren Sie Ihr erstes Java - Quellprogramm in Ihren Ordner auf dem Server, damit dieser historische Moment ja nicht verlorengeht (Festplatte "P:", erstellen Sie ev. einen Ordner "Java").


 
  Wir wollen das Programm analysieren, soweit das schon jetzt sinnvoll ist. Damit wir das Programm gemeinsam am Tisch besprechen können, drucken Sie es sich bitte aus zusammen mit den nachfolgenden zehn Besprechungspunkten.

Falls Sie zu Hause mit Java arbeiten möchten, sollten Sie sich dort das Development Kit einrichten. Mehr dazu erfahren Sie im Kapitel SDK.

Wenn Sie mit allem fertig sind, sitzen Sie bitte mit den zwei Papieren an den Tisch und versuchen Sie die zehn "Dinge" zu erraten.